Pearl necklaces remain classics for a reason. The decisive factor for a beautiful pearl necklace is always the so-called match, i.e. the selection of matching, high-quality pearls. In this case, we have succeeded particularly well in finding pearls in matching colors and combining them into a necklace. The pearls in the vintage necklace have a wonderful, uniform creamy white color with a shimmering overlay. The pearls are individually knotted and strung in a graduated pattern, which means they become thicker towards the middle. With a length of 62 cm, the necklace is a so-called matinée pearl necklace. The yellow gold clasp is also particularly beautiful and of high quality: it is crafted in the shape of a ball and set with two diamonds, rubies, sapphires and emeralds, creating a colorful eye-catcher. Pearl necklaces come in a wide variety of lengths, which is why they are so versatile. Whether sporty or elegant, each pearl necklace can enhance clothing in different ways: we recommend the classic "choker" (35-40 cm) for casual wear and in business life, the slightly longer "matinée necklace" (50-60 cm) for more festive occasions and the 70-90 cm long "opera length", also known as "sautoir", tied single or double, is a luxurious eye-catcher for the grand ball. A treasure from the depths of the sea - In many cultures around the world, pearls have a deeply symbolic character. In China, they are a symbol of wealth, wisdom and dignity; in Japan, they signify good luck; in India, the wealth of children. The ancient Greeks and Romans were already very fond of pearls as pieces of jewellery: the Greek word "margarita" was also used to refer to the beloved, a term that has survived to this day in the name Margarete.
